Bengals | Carson Palmer still working out
Sat, 16 Jul 2011 23:03:50 -0700

Cincinnati Bengals QB Carson Palmer confirmed to reporters Friday, July 15, that he continues to have the same throwing program this offseason than he has had in the past. He is expected to retire if he is not traded by the Bengals. The leading contenders for his services are the Miami Dolphins, San Francisco 49ers and Seattle Seahawks.

Source: The Cincinnati Enquirer - Joe Reedy
